How to Decorate a Breakfast Bar: Transform Your Kitchen into a Stylish Dining Area

Transforming your kitchen into a stylish and functional dining area can be a rewarding project. One of the key elements in achieving this is by focusing on how to decorate a breakfast bar. A breakfast bar can serve as a cozy spot for morning meals, a place to enjoy a glass of wine with friends, or even a makeshift office. In this article, we will provide you with some creative and practical tips on how to decorate a breakfast bar that will enhance the aesthetic appeal of your kitchen.

1. Choose the Right Style

The first step in decorating your breakfast bar is to determine the style that complements your kitchen’s overall design. Whether you prefer a modern, minimalist look or a rustic, farmhouse style, the choice of style will set the tone for the rest of your decor. Consider the following styles:

  • Modern: Opt for sleek, clean lines and materials like stainless steel, glass, and marble.
  • Contemporary: Mix and match materials, such as wood and metal, to create a unique and eclectic look.
  • Rustic: Embrace natural elements, such as wood, stone, and plants, to create a warm and inviting atmosphere.
  • Traditional: Stick to classic designs, such as cabinets with ornate handles and dark wood finishes.

2. Select the Perfect Color Scheme

The color scheme you choose for your breakfast bar will play a significant role in the overall ambiance of your kitchen. Here are some color combinations to consider:

  • Neutral: Opt for shades of white, gray, or beige for a timeless and versatile look.
  • Bold: Use vibrant colors like red, blue, or green to make a statement and add energy to the space.
  • Pastel: Soft colors like pink, lavender, or mint can create a serene and relaxing atmosphere.

3. Incorporate Lighting

Proper lighting is essential for a well-decorated breakfast bar. Consider the following lighting options:

  • Under-cabinet lighting: Enhance the functionality of your breakfast bar by illuminating the countertops.
  • Task lighting: Use pendant lights or wall sconces to provide focused lighting for specific tasks.
  • Accent lighting: Add a touch of elegance with decorative lights or candles to highlight certain features of your breakfast bar.

4. Add Storage Solutions

Storage is a crucial element in how to decorate a breakfast bar. Keep your space organized and clutter-free with the following storage solutions:

  • Cabinets: Install cabinets beneath your breakfast bar to store dishes, glasses, and other kitchenware.
  • Open shelving: Display your favorite dishes, cookbooks, or decorative items on open shelves for a stylish and functional look.
  • Drawer organizers: Utilize drawer organizers to keep cutlery, utensils, and other small items in order.

5. Incorporate Personal Touches

Finally, add personal touches to your breakfast bar to make it uniquely yours. Consider the following ideas:

  • Artwork: Hang a piece of artwork or a collection of photos to add a touch of personality.
  • Decorative objects: Place decorative objects, such as vases, candles, or a small plant, on your breakfast bar to create a cozy atmosphere.
  • Seating: Choose comfortable seating options, such as bar stools or a bench, to complete your breakfast bar area.
